3-Day Family-Friendly Itinerary in Delhi

Friday September 22: Exploring Historical Wonders

In the morning, start your Delhi adventure by visiting the iconic Red Fort. Marvel at its stunning architecture and learn about its historical significance. Afterward, head to Jama Masjid, one of the largest mosques in India, and soak in its grandeur. In the afternoon, make your way to the fascinating Qutub Minar,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Climb to the top for panoramic views of the city. As the evening approaches, take a leisurely stroll in Lodhi Gardens, a tranquil oasis amidst the bustling city.

  • Red Fort: Estimated cost - INR 500 per person,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Jama Masjid: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Qutub Minar: Estimated cost - INR 500 per person,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Lodhi Gardens: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1 hour

Saturday September 23: Cultural Immersion

Start your day by exploring the enchanting Akshardham Temple. Admire its intricate architecture and enjoy the breathtaking musical fountain show. In the afternoon, visit the National Museum to delve into India's rich cultural heritage. Afterwards, take a rickshaw ride through the bustling lanes of Chandni Chowk, one of Delhi's oldest and busiest markets. Try delicious street food and shop for souvenirs. In the evening, catch a traditional dance performance at the prestigious Kingdom of Dreams.

  • Akshardham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 3 hours
  • National Museum: Estimated cost - INR 20 per person,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Chandni Chowk: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Kingdom of Dreams: Estimated cost - INR 1500 per person, Time spent - 3 hours

Sunday September 24: Modern Delhi Exploration

Begin your day by visiting the fascinating Lotus Temple, renowned for its unique lotus-shaped architecture. Spend the morning in this serene place of worship. In the afternoon, head to the National Rail Museum, a delight for train enthusiasts of all ages. Explore the vintage locomotives and take a joyride on a toy train. Wrap up your Delhi experience by visiting the modern and vibrant Hauz Khas Village. Explore its art galleries, boutique stores, and enjoy a meal at one of the trendy cafes.

  • Lotus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• National Rail Museum: Estimated cost - INR 50 per person,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Hauz Khas Village: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ique family experience, visit the KidZania Delhi, an interactive edutainment center where children can role-play various professions in a mini city. Another hidden gem is the Nehru Planetarium, offering fascinating shows and exhibits about space and astronomy. If your family enjoys nature, explore the Delhi Zoo, home to a wide range of animals and birds. Lastly, don't miss the opportunity to try delicious street food at the Paranthe Wali Gali in Old Delhi, known for its mouthwatering stuffed parathas.
